As a public school system, we welcome all students who live within the district's boundaries and meet state age and health requirements.

  • Parents and guardians must be legal residents within the school district’s boundaries. Parents and guardians will be required to prove residency before a student’s enrollment is completed. Board of Education Policy 7:60 (Residence) and 7:60 AP-2 provide regulations and information regarding residency. In particular, Administrative Procedure 7:60 AP-2 (Residence) provides information on the documentation that will be required at the point of enrollment for proof of residency.   • Enrollment for new and transfer students begins by calling to make an appointment with our registrar at 708-448-2800.

    Parents of students who are transferring from other schools must arrange for the transfer of student records and must present a letter of good standing. The Illinois State Board of Education form must be used. Additional regulations concerning transfer students are contained in Board of Education Policy 7:50 (School Admissions and Student Transfers To and From Non-District Schools).

  • Do you have concerns about speech, language, or learning for your 3 or 4 year old child?  The program at Worth School District 127 is for children that are at risk of future academic difficulties who would benefit from a school experience prior to Kindergarten.  Eligibility is determined by a screening assessment and parent interview.

    The screening process includes evaluation of the following areas:

    • Speech and language
    • Vision and hearing
    • Fine & Gross Motor Skills
    • Cognitive Skills

    Children must be age 3 by September 1st.  The screening takes approximately 1.5 – 2 hours and is provided at no cost to the parents and children at Worth School District 127.  Space is limited in our program.  Screening does not guarantee placement.

  • Students must be age 5 by September 1, 2026 in order to be enrolled in Kindergarten for the 2026-2027 school year. Board of Education Policy 7:50 (School Admissions and Student Transfers To and From Non-District Schools) states the age requirement. Click on the link below to obtain more detailed information.

    The original birth certificate for the child must be presented at the District Office.  The birth certificate is a mandatory document.

    Only the parent or legal guardian may register a child in the district.

    Residency Form

    Health forms are due on or before the first day of school.  You may drop the completed forms off at the district office.

    Physical examination and immunizations – Required at the start of the 2026-2027 school year.  The deadline for the physical examination form is October 16, 2026.

    Lead screening – Required one time prior to entering Kindergarten for students 6 years or younger.

    Dental and Eye Examinations – Required for students entering Kindergarten.  Dental and eye exam forms are required.

  • Students who attended Worth School District 127 schools during the 2025-2026 school year will start registration through the PowerSchool Parent Portal when a notification email is received. Residency will need to be proven after registration. Registration is complete when:

    1. Residency is proven.
    2. Students are enrolled online.
    3. Fees are paid. (Graduation and Band fees)
